S. Mestre is a scholar working on Water Science and Technology, Materials Chemistry and Inorganic Chemistry. According to data from OpenAlex, S. Mestre has authored 71 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Water Science and Technology, 21 papers in Materials Chemistry and 20 papers in Inorganic Chemistry. Recurrent topics in S. Mestre’s work include Pigment Synthesis and Properties (19 papers), Advanced Photocatalysis Techniques (14 papers) and Advanced oxidation water treatment (14 papers). S. Mestre is often cited by papers focused on Pigment Synthesis and Properties (19 papers), Advanced Photocatalysis Techniques (14 papers) and Advanced oxidation water treatment (14 papers). S. Mestre collaborates with scholars based in Spain, United States and Japan. S. Mestre's co-authors include V. Pérez‐Herranz, M. García-Gabaldón, V. Sanz, E. Sánchez and J. Gilabert and has published in prestigious journals such as Scientific Reports, Journal of Cleaner Production and Chemosphere.
